Expansive laminoplasty for lumbar spinal stenosis
International Orthopaedics
|January 1, 1990
Summary
Expansive laminoplasty, a surgical technique, proved effective for treating degenerative lumbar spinal stenosis in four patients. This method successfully enlarged the spinal canal and enhanced spinal stability, yielding very satisfactory outcomes.

Background:
- Degenerative lumbar spinal stenosis can cause severe low back and sciatic pain.
- Intraspinal ossification and developmental stenosis are contributing factors.
- Expansive laminoplasty is a known technique for cervical myelopathy.
Observation:
- The study applied expansive laminoplasty to four patients with lumbar spinal stenosis.
- Patients were relatively young and presented with severe symptoms.
- The condition involved intraspinal ossification at multiple spinal segments.
Findings:
- Osteoplastic enlargement of the lumbar spinal canal was achieved.
- Reinforcement of spinal stability was a key advantage.
- Follow-up ranged from 2 to 5.5 years.
- All cases demonstrated very satisfactory results.
Implications:
- Expansive laminoplasty is a viable surgical option for specific cases of lumbar spinal stenosis.
- The procedure offers benefits in canal enlargement and spinal stability.
- Further research may explore wider applications of this technique in lumbar spine surgery.
